Just received an email from AWS Training & Certification stating that my result is now available for the SAA CO2 exam.
Not a surprise that I failed with a score of 100. Reiterating the fact that I could not view a single question but instead got the following error message.: "Unable to resume because the test is already complete".
Losing 150$ and not even getting to take the exam due to a technical error feels unfair and extremely disheartening.
It would be really really helpful if someone could look into this. Please.
vidushi,
I am sorry to hear about your frustrating experience. I have reviewed your account and removed the "fail" grade. This also removes the 14-day retake policy so you can schedule the exam for as soon as today if you would like. I have also confirmed that there is an open case for you with the PSI customer support team. They will be reaching out soon with a resolution. If they confirm the technical issue, they will provide a voucher.
